出品|MS08067实验室(www.ms08067.com)
通过想要入门Java代码安全审计的朋友们进行交流,发现朋友们对这几个问题有着比较高的关注度:
问题1:在参与系列课程前,需要把Java掌握到什么程度?
问题2:可否补充Java基础知识?
问题3:已经学过Java SE的基础语法,有没有Spring的相关学习资料?
问题4:有没有Java代码审计的学习路线?
对于问题1,在着手进行学习前,并不要求小伙伴们具备优秀的Java开发能力,但要求小伙伴们对Java SE、Java EE的基础知识有着初步的了解。
对于问题2,让我在此处跟大家分享Java SE、JavaEE的学习资料:
【PART 1】Java SE
(1)梁勇(Daniel Liang)的《Java语言程序设计基础篇》
链接:
https://pan.baidu.com/s/1HcLVpUbS5AYprwJcGEbtRw
提取码:g8r6
(2)Alibaba Java 技术图谱
Alibaba Java 由“Java课程专家组”倾力打造的行业权威图谱,11个知识点,35门课程 ,近千课时,3个体验场景,19场公开课。从新手入门,到高级工程师进阶,从理论学习,到实践应用,一张图谱讲透Java!
链接:https://developer.aliyun.com/graph/java
(3)Java SE 思维导图
链接:
https://www.ms08067.com/about/javase.jpg
(4)JDK在线文档(查阅开发文档还是必须的)
《在线文档-jdk-zh》
链接:
https://tool.oschina.net/apidocs/apidoc?api=jdk-zh
【PART 2】Java EE
已经初步接触过Java EE的小伙伴也可以阅读王松的《Spring Boot + Vue全栈开发实战》等书籍。
链接:
https://pan.baidu.com/s/1hmpsXlT86QLWf3CqpdgL2Q
提取码:j1zk
值得注意的是,各类基础知识的重要性是不均等的。为了帮助小伙伴们铺平学习道路,我们已在《Java代码安全审计(入门篇)》第四章帮小伙伴们补充关键的预备知识。
对于问题3,让我在这里跟大家推荐一位老师的Spring框架教程“Spring学习《狂神说Java》 笔记”
链接:
https://blog.csdn.net/okForrest27/article/details/106537880/
这位老师讲得非常的好,B站也有这位老师的视频,他的昵称叫“遇见狂神说”。有需要的同学可以先看一看。
对于问题4,这篇博客介绍了关于Java 代码审计的学习路线,写得很好,推荐给大家。
链接:
https://www.cnblogs.com/afanti/p/13156152.html
观看《Java代码安全审计(入门篇)》配套讲解视频及技术解答
可加入“java代码审计”配套星球
星球建立的根本性目的是“通过较详细的漏洞点剖析以及代码审计的实战演示”帮助读者能够更快的入门Java代码审计,从此迈入Java代码审计的大门。
扫描下方二维码查看星球具体内容,星球附赠全书完整全套源码、工具及环境、配套的Docker镜像!
PS:广而告之
1.同时购买多个星球享受最低至6.3折折扣(第1个原价,第2个8.8折,第3个8.3折,第4个7.8折,第5个7.3折,第6个6.8折,第7个6.3折)
2.三人成团,一起购买可在享受第一条折扣基础上再合并打9折
3.支持分期付款及花呗付费
4.分享有礼,16%分享奖励,以当前价格计,您只需将我们推荐给6位付费新星友,您就完全赚回“门票”支出了
扫描下方二维码加入星球学习
加入后会邀请你进入内部微信群,内部微信群永久有效!
加入星球和5000位同学一起学习吧!